Ob, Ob Rivernoun
a major river of western Siberia; flows generally northward and westward to the Gulf of Ob and the Kara Sea

ob river
The Ob River is one of the major rivers in western Siberia, Russia, and is considered the world's seventh-longest river. It stretches more than 3,700 kilometers from the Altai Mountains to the Arctic Ocean. The river is crucial for irrigation, hydroelectric power, and fishing. Its major tributary is the Irtysh River. The Ob River is known for forming the Ob-Irtysh River system, the longest river system in Siberia and Asia.

Ob River
The Ob River, also Obi, is a major river in western Siberia, Russia and is the world's seventh longest river. It is the westernmost of the three great Siberian rivers that flow into the Arctic Ocean. The Gulf of Ob is the world's longest estuary.
